I have a high-level schematic which only contains sheet symbols whose ports are wired together to define the inter-sheet connections.

I am trying to do pin swapping on components contained in a schematic which is referenced by multiple "copies" of the same sheet symbol, i.e. one schematic -> 4 sheet symbols. Altium is not happy when I try to push the pin swapping from PCB > schematic, the ECO fails with red crosses.

Is there a specific way to approach pin swapping when dealing with a several sheet symbols that reference the same schematic?

Are you trying to swap the pins on all instances of the schematic sheet, or only on particular instance(s)?  I don't think the latter would work, because the underlying sheet would have to be different for the different instances. 

Can you share the exact messages you get when you try to push the swap back the the sch?

Hello and thank you for your reply. I managed to get it working in the end, so for anyone that is interested...

I got rid of the multi-sheets and instead made unique sheets for all the sections of the design.
I separated the wires and nets so that they "floated" on the schematic sheets as per the attached screenshot.
Under Project > Project Options I set to allow pin swapping by, "Adding/Removing Net-Labels". This ensures that your schematic symbols remain intact.
